Local heating of a medium in the nanovicinity of the Co-57 nucleus that underwent radioactive decay to Fe-57

Process of formation of the Auger blob (nanosized cloud of two or three hundred of ion-electron pairs) around a Co-57 radioactive atom after E-capture followed by the emission of a cascade of Auger electrons by the daughter atom Fe-57 has been considered. The effect of local temperature elevation in the Auger blob caused by energy emission during ionization slowing down of Auger electrons and the secondary electrons generated by them is discussed. Some consequences of this effect have been noted.
